
Warning against Japan's administrative guidance on Line stake
Rep. Yoon Sang-hyun of the ruling People Power Party holds a news conference at the National Assembly in Seoul on May 13, 2024, warning that the directive from the Japanese government to compel the divestment of Naver's stake in the operator of Line, Japan's largest messaging app, would pour cold water on relations between the two nations. Naver has faced pressure from the Japanese government to "reconsider its capital ties" in LY Corp., the operator of Line, which is controlled by a joint venture between Naver of South Korea and SoftBank of Japan, following a significant data breach of user information.
